第12課添加交互 教學(xué)實(shí)錄-_第1頁
第12課添加交互 教學(xué)實(shí)錄-_第2頁
第12課添加交互 教學(xué)實(shí)錄-_第3頁
第12課添加交互 教學(xué)實(shí)錄-_第4頁
全文預(yù)覽已結(jié)束

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

第12課添加交互教學(xué)實(shí)錄--一、課程基本信息

1.課程名稱:信息技術(shù)——添加交互

2.教學(xué)年級和班級:八年級(3)班

3.授課時(shí)間:2022年10月15日

4.教學(xué)時(shí)數(shù):1課時(shí)

本節(jié)課為《信息技術(shù)》第12課“添加交互”,內(nèi)容主要包括:了解交互式媒體的概念,學(xué)習(xí)在網(wǎng)頁中添加按鈕、鏈接和圖像映射等交互元素,以及掌握使用JavaScript編寫簡單的交互式程序。二、學(xué)情分析與內(nèi)容規(guī)劃

1.學(xué)情分析:學(xué)生已經(jīng)掌握了基礎(chǔ)的計(jì)算機(jī)操作技能和網(wǎng)頁設(shè)計(jì)的基本概念,但對于交互式網(wǎng)頁的設(shè)計(jì)和JavaScript編程有一定的陌生感,且在實(shí)際操作中可能遇到編程邏輯和代碼調(diào)試的困難。

2.內(nèi)容規(guī)劃:本節(jié)課將圍繞交互式網(wǎng)頁設(shè)計(jì)的基礎(chǔ)知識,首先通過案例展示讓學(xué)生理解交互式元素的作用和重要性,然后引導(dǎo)學(xué)生學(xué)習(xí)如何在網(wǎng)頁中添加按鈕、鏈接和圖像映射,并逐步引入JavaScript的基本語法和簡單程序編寫,讓學(xué)生通過動(dòng)手實(shí)踐,完成一個(gè)簡單的交互式網(wǎng)頁設(shè)計(jì)任務(wù)。內(nèi)容將包括理論知識講解、實(shí)例分析、課堂練習(xí)和作品展示四個(gè)環(huán)節(jié)。三、教學(xué)難點(diǎn)與重點(diǎn)

1.教學(xué)重點(diǎn)

本節(jié)課的教學(xué)重點(diǎn)是:

-交互式網(wǎng)頁的基本概念和組成。

-按鈕和鏈接的添加與設(shè)置。

-JavaScript的基礎(chǔ)語法和簡單交互程序的編寫。

具體細(xì)節(jié)如下:

-理解交互式網(wǎng)頁的概念,能夠識別并使用HTML中的`<button>`和`<a>`標(biāo)簽。

-掌握如何為按鈕和鏈接添加CSS樣式,以及如何通過JavaScript響應(yīng)點(diǎn)擊事件。

-學(xué)習(xí)JavaScript中的變量定義、數(shù)據(jù)類型、基本運(yùn)算符和控制結(jié)構(gòu)。

例如,教師可以通過以下步驟講解重點(diǎn)內(nèi)容:

-展示一個(gè)簡單的交互式網(wǎng)頁實(shí)例,讓學(xué)生直觀感受交互元素的作用。

-逐步講解如何插入按鈕和鏈接,并演示如何為它們添加樣式和功能。

2.教學(xué)難點(diǎn)

本節(jié)課的教學(xué)難點(diǎn)包括:

-JavaScript的語法規(guī)則和邏輯理解。

-事件處理和函數(shù)調(diào)用的概念。

-交互式程序的調(diào)試。

具體細(xì)節(jié)如下:

-學(xué)生可能不熟悉JavaScript的語法,如變量聲明、函數(shù)定義和調(diào)用等。

-對于事件處理,學(xué)生可能難以理解如何捕捉用戶操作并執(zhí)行相應(yīng)的代碼。

-程序調(diào)試時(shí),學(xué)生可能無法準(zhǔn)確識別和修正錯(cuò)誤。

舉例說明如下:

-教師可以舉例說明JavaScript中的變量聲明和賦值,如`varx=5;`,并解釋變量的作用域和類型。

-在講解事件處理時(shí),教師可以通過一個(gè)按鈕點(diǎn)擊事件來演示,如`document.getElementById("myButton").onclick=function(){alert("按鈕被點(diǎn)擊了!");};`。

-對于調(diào)試,教師可以展示一個(gè)包含錯(cuò)誤的代碼示例,并引導(dǎo)學(xué)生逐步檢查并修正錯(cuò)誤,如忘記添加分號、括號不匹配等常見錯(cuò)誤。通過這樣的實(shí)例,幫助學(xué)生理解并克服編程中的難點(diǎn)。四、教學(xué)方法與策略

1.本節(jié)課將采用講授與案例研究相結(jié)合的教學(xué)方法,通過教師講解交互式網(wǎng)頁設(shè)計(jì)的基本概念和JavaScript編程的基礎(chǔ)知識,同時(shí)展示具體的案例,讓學(xué)生能夠直觀地理解理論內(nèi)容在實(shí)際中的應(yīng)用。

2.教學(xué)活動(dòng)將包括小組討論和項(xiàng)目導(dǎo)向?qū)W習(xí),學(xué)生在小組內(nèi)討論如何實(shí)現(xiàn)特定的交互功能,并在教師的指導(dǎo)下,通過項(xiàng)目實(shí)踐來構(gòu)建一個(gè)簡單的交互式網(wǎng)頁。這樣的實(shí)踐活動(dòng)旨在促進(jìn)學(xué)生之間的合作與交流,同時(shí)提高解決問題的能力。

3.教學(xué)媒體使用將側(cè)重于多媒體演示和在線編程環(huán)境,教師將使用PowerPoint展示關(guān)鍵概念和步驟,同時(shí)利用在線編程平臺讓學(xué)生實(shí)時(shí)編寫和測試代碼,這樣既能提高教學(xué)的互動(dòng)性,也能讓學(xué)生在實(shí)踐中學(xué)習(xí)。五、教學(xué)過程

1.導(dǎo)入環(huán)節(jié)(約5分鐘)

教師通過展示一個(gè)簡單的交互式網(wǎng)頁實(shí)例,如一個(gè)帶有按鈕和動(dòng)畫效果的小游戲,來吸引學(xué)生的注意力。接著,提出問題:“你們覺得這個(gè)網(wǎng)頁為什么會動(dòng)?它是如何響應(yīng)用戶操作的?”通過這些問題激發(fā)學(xué)生的好奇心和探究欲,引導(dǎo)學(xué)生思考交互式網(wǎng)頁的原理。

2.新知學(xué)習(xí)(約25分鐘)

教師首先講解交互式網(wǎng)頁的基本概念,包括交互元素的種類和作用。接著,通過PPT展示HTML中`<button>`和`<a>`標(biāo)簽的使用方法,并示范如何為這些元素添加CSS樣式以改善網(wǎng)頁外觀。

隨后,教師引入JavaScript的基礎(chǔ)語法,包括變量聲明、基本數(shù)據(jù)類型、運(yùn)算符和條件語句。通過講解和代碼演示,讓學(xué)生理解如何編寫一個(gè)簡單的交互式程序。例如,教師可以編寫一個(gè)簡單的JavaScript程序,當(dāng)用戶點(diǎn)擊按鈕時(shí),網(wǎng)頁上顯示一條消息。

在講解過程中,教師會暫停并提問,確保學(xué)生能夠跟上講解的節(jié)奏,理解每個(gè)概念和步驟。同時(shí),教師也會鼓勵(lì)學(xué)生提問,及時(shí)解答他們的疑惑。

3.實(shí)踐應(yīng)用(約10分鐘)

學(xué)生被分成小組,每組使用在線編程環(huán)境,根據(jù)教師提供的指導(dǎo),嘗試編寫一個(gè)包含按鈕和簡單交互功能的網(wǎng)頁。教師會巡回指導(dǎo),幫助學(xué)生解決編程中遇到的問題。學(xué)生在實(shí)踐中應(yīng)用剛剛學(xué)到的知識,通過編寫代碼來實(shí)現(xiàn)交互功能。

4.總結(jié)與提升(約5分鐘)

教師邀請幾個(gè)小組分享他們的作品,并討論在編寫代碼時(shí)遇到的問題以及如何解決這些問題。教師總結(jié)本節(jié)課的核心內(nèi)容,強(qiáng)調(diào)JavaScript編程的基本原則和交互式網(wǎng)頁設(shè)計(jì)的重要性。

最后,教師提出一些拓展性問題,鼓勵(lì)學(xué)生在課后繼續(xù)探索交互式網(wǎng)頁設(shè)計(jì)的更多可能性,并預(yù)告下一節(jié)課的學(xué)習(xí)內(nèi)容,為學(xué)生的持續(xù)學(xué)習(xí)提供方向。六、教學(xué)反思與改進(jìn)

這節(jié)課學(xué)生對于交互式網(wǎng)頁的設(shè)計(jì)表現(xiàn)出濃厚的興趣,但在JavaScript編程部分,我發(fā)現(xiàn)部分學(xué)生對語法和邏輯理解上存在困難。我意識到可能是我講解的速度過快,沒有給足學(xué)生消化的時(shí)間。下次我會放慢節(jié)奏,確保每個(gè)學(xué)生都能跟上。

另外,我注意到在實(shí)踐環(huán)節(jié),一些小組在協(xié)作上出現(xiàn)了一些問題,這可能是因?yàn)槲覍π〗M合作的指導(dǎo)和監(jiān)督不夠。我計(jì)劃在下一節(jié)課上,提前制定更明確的合作規(guī)則和角色分配,以促進(jìn)更高效的團(tuán)隊(duì)合作。

此外,我會考慮增加一些課后練習(xí),讓學(xué)生能夠在家中繼續(xù)鞏固所學(xué)知識,尤其是編程實(shí)踐,這樣有助于加深理解和記憶。通過這些改進(jìn),我相信能夠幫助學(xué)生們更好地掌握交互式網(wǎng)頁設(shè)計(jì)的技能。七、教學(xué)資源拓展

1.拓展資源

-交互式網(wǎng)頁設(shè)計(jì)案例:收集一些優(yōu)秀的交互式網(wǎng)頁設(shè)計(jì)案例,包括商業(yè)網(wǎng)站、個(gè)人博客、在線教育平臺等,讓學(xué)生分析這些案例中使用的交互元素和JavaScript代碼。

-JavaScript編程教程:提供一些JavaScript基礎(chǔ)教程,涵蓋變量、函數(shù)、事件處理、DOM操作等關(guān)鍵知識點(diǎn),幫助學(xué)生加深對JavaScript編程的理解。

-交互式網(wǎng)頁設(shè)計(jì)工具:介紹一些可以用于創(chuàng)建交互式網(wǎng)頁的軟件和在線工具,如AdobeDreamweaver、Bootstrap等,讓學(xué)生了解這些工具的使用方法和特點(diǎn)。

-編程社區(qū)和論壇:推薦學(xué)生加入一些編程社區(qū)和論壇,如StackOverflow、GitHub等,這些社區(qū)和論壇可以為學(xué)生提供編程幫助和資源共享。

2.拓展建議

-鼓勵(lì)學(xué)生課余時(shí)間閱讀JavaScript相關(guān)的書籍和在線教程,特別是那些提供實(shí)例分析的教程,可以幫助學(xué)生將理論知識應(yīng)用到實(shí)際編程中。

-建議學(xué)生嘗試自己編寫簡單的JavaScript程序,如制作一個(gè)簡單的計(jì)算器、一個(gè)動(dòng)態(tài)的時(shí)鐘或者一個(gè)網(wǎng)頁小游戲,通過實(shí)際操作來提高編程技能。

-提議學(xué)生參與在線編程挑戰(zhàn)和競賽,如Codecademy的挑戰(zhàn)、LeetCode的編程題等,這些挑戰(zhàn)能夠鍛煉學(xué)生的編程思維和問題解決能力。

-鼓勵(lì)學(xué)生關(guān)注最新的前端開發(fā)技術(shù)和趨勢,如響應(yīng)式設(shè)計(jì)、前端框架(如React、Vue.js等),了解這些技術(shù)在實(shí)際開發(fā)中的應(yīng)用。

-建議學(xué)生定期瀏覽一些知名的設(shè)計(jì)和編程博客,如SmashingMagazine、CSS-Tricks等,這些博客提供了大量的設(shè)計(jì)靈感和編程技巧。

-推薦學(xué)生參與開源項(xiàng)目,通過貢獻(xiàn)代碼到GitHub上的開源項(xiàng)目,學(xué)生不僅能夠提高編程能力,還能學(xué)會如何在一個(gè)團(tuán)隊(duì)中協(xié)作。

-鼓勵(lì)學(xué)生參加學(xué)校或社區(qū)組織的編程工作坊和講座,這些活動(dòng)可以讓學(xué)生接觸到業(yè)界的專業(yè)人士,了解實(shí)際工作中的編程挑戰(zhàn)和解決方案。通過這些拓展資源和學(xué)習(xí)建議,學(xué)生可以在課后繼續(xù)深化對交互式網(wǎng)頁設(shè)計(jì)和JavaScript編程的理解,提高自己的實(shí)踐能力。八、教學(xué)評估與改進(jìn)

1.教學(xué)評估

在這節(jié)課中,我觀察到學(xué)生們對于交互式網(wǎng)頁設(shè)計(jì)的基本概念有了較好的理解,他們能夠跟隨我的講解,識別并使用HTML中的按鈕和鏈接標(biāo)簽。在實(shí)踐環(huán)節(jié),大部分學(xué)生能夠成功添加交互元素,并在網(wǎng)頁上實(shí)現(xiàn)基本的交互功能。然而,我也注意到在JavaScript編程部分,一些學(xué)生在語法和邏輯上遇到了難題,他們對于變量的聲明和函數(shù)的調(diào)用感到困惑,這影響了他們完成交互式程序的能力。

2.教學(xué)改進(jìn)

針對學(xué)生在JavaScript編程上遇到的困難,我計(jì)劃在下一節(jié)課上增加一些互動(dòng)環(huán)節(jié),比如小組討論和問題解答,這樣可以幫助學(xué)生更好地理解和消化編程概念。我會準(zhǔn)備一些更簡單的編程練習(xí),讓學(xué)生在課堂上實(shí)時(shí)編寫和測試代碼,以便他們能夠立即看到編程結(jié)果,并及時(shí)得到反饋。

為了提高學(xué)生的實(shí)踐能力,我打算調(diào)整課堂時(shí)間分配,增加實(shí)踐環(huán)節(jié)的時(shí)間,讓學(xué)生有更多機(jī)會動(dòng)手操作。同時(shí),我會在課堂上提供更多的實(shí)例,通過實(shí)例來解釋復(fù)雜的編程概念,幫助學(xué)生建立起直觀的理解。

我還計(jì)劃在課后提供一些額外的學(xué)習(xí)資源,包括在線教程和視頻,這樣學(xué)生可以在自己的節(jié)奏下復(fù)習(xí)和深入學(xué)習(xí)。我會鼓勵(lì)學(xué)生利用這些資源來自我提高,并在下一節(jié)課上分享他們的學(xué)習(xí)成果。

此外,我會更加關(guān)注學(xué)生的個(gè)別差異,對于編程基礎(chǔ)較弱的學(xué)生,我會提供額外的輔導(dǎo)和支持,確保他們不會落后。我會定期檢查學(xué)生的學(xué)習(xí)進(jìn)度,并根據(jù)需要調(diào)整教學(xué)計(jì)劃。

最后,我會考慮在未來的課程中加入更多的項(xiàng)目導(dǎo)向?qū)W習(xí),讓學(xué)生通過完成一個(gè)完整的交互式網(wǎng)頁項(xiàng)目來綜合運(yùn)用所學(xué)知識。這樣的項(xiàng)目不僅能夠提高學(xué)生的技能,還能讓他們體驗(yàn)到實(shí)際開發(fā)的流程和樂趣。通過這些改進(jìn)措施,我相信能夠幫助學(xué)生更好地掌握交互式網(wǎng)頁設(shè)計(jì)的技能,并激發(fā)他們對編程的興趣。九、評價(jià)與反饋機(jī)制

1.過程評價(jià):在小組討論和角色扮演中,我會密切觀察學(xué)生的參與度,注意他們是否能夠積極表達(dá)自己的想法,并與同伴有效溝通。我會給予及時(shí)的口頭反饋,認(rèn)可學(xué)生的積極表現(xiàn),

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

最新文檔

評論

0/150

提交評論